산-염기 처리한 게 껍질에 의한 수중의 납 이온 제거 KCI 등재

Removal of Pb2+ ion from aqueous solution using crab shell treated by acid and alkali

초록

In order to examine the pre-treatment effect of crab shell on Pb2+ removal by crab shell in aqueous solution, acid and alkali pre-treated crab shell were used. Electron microscopy techniques such as TEM (transmission electron microscopy) and SEM (scanning electron microscopy), and EDX (energy dispersive X-ray) and FTIR (Fourier transform infrared) spectrometry techniques were used to investigate the process of Pb2+ removal by acid and alkali pre-treated crab shell. The Pb2+ removal by acid pre-treated crab shell was much lower than that by untreated crab shell because of the decrease of CaCO3 from the crab shell. However, the Pb2+ removal by alkali pre-treated crab shell increased compared to that by untreated crab shell. The results were confirmed by TEM, SEM, EDX and FTIR.
